#include <GeneralMatrixMatrix.h>
Public Types | |
typedef Lhs::Scalar | LhsScalar |
typedef Scalar | ResScalar |
typedef Rhs::Scalar | RhsScalar |
Public Member Functions | |
GeneralProduct (const Lhs &lhs, const Rhs &rhs) | |
template<typename Dest > | |
void | scaleAndAddTo (Dest &dst, Scalar alpha) const |
Private Types | |
enum | { MaxDepthAtCompileTime = EIGEN_SIZE_MIN_PREFER_FIXED(Lhs::MaxColsAtCompileTime,Rhs::MaxRowsAtCompileTime) } |
Definition at line 379 of file GeneralMatrixMatrix.h.
typedef Lhs::Scalar Eigen::GeneralProduct< Lhs, Rhs, GemmProduct >::LhsScalar |
Reimplemented from Eigen::ProductBase< GeneralProduct< Lhs, Rhs, GemmProduct >, Lhs, Rhs >.
Definition at line 388 of file GeneralMatrixMatrix.h.
typedef Scalar Eigen::GeneralProduct< Lhs, Rhs, GemmProduct >::ResScalar |
Definition at line 390 of file GeneralMatrixMatrix.h.
typedef Rhs::Scalar Eigen::GeneralProduct< Lhs, Rhs, GemmProduct >::RhsScalar |
Reimplemented from Eigen::ProductBase< GeneralProduct< Lhs, Rhs, GemmProduct >, Lhs, Rhs >.
Definition at line 389 of file GeneralMatrixMatrix.h.
anonymous enum [private] |
Definition at line 382 of file GeneralMatrixMatrix.h.
Eigen::GeneralProduct< Lhs, Rhs, GemmProduct >::GeneralProduct | ( | const Lhs & | lhs, |
const Rhs & | rhs | ||
) | [inline] |
Definition at line 392 of file GeneralMatrixMatrix.h.
void Eigen::GeneralProduct< Lhs, Rhs, GemmProduct >::scaleAndAddTo | ( | Dest & | dst, |
Scalar | alpha | ||
) | const [inline] |
Reimplemented from Eigen::ProductBase< GeneralProduct< Lhs, Rhs, GemmProduct >, Lhs, Rhs >.
Definition at line 398 of file GeneralMatrixMatrix.h.